Output 62ffbe0415dc5ebe411260f39166ae86aeaee6231f2566012de0125d955d91f2:21

value
6302672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 873465e9cfd3a0b07bb43454c818eea5c6ec5851 OP_EQUAL
address
3E1uv8BQc1eQ4zhoNnS4hcoj3zjK9xwQ4A
transaction
62ffbe0415dc5ebe411260f39166ae86aeaee6231f2566012de0125d955d91f2
spent
true